Transaction 17f15878bfdad890c6db6f93736719713edc995f500c5ee50d66c23d05a13d29

1 Input
2 Outputs
  • 17f15878bfdad890c6db6f93736719713edc995f500c5ee50d66c23d05a13d29:0
  • value  154195
    address  37KNx1Ap1SF4XUMbfD54g1LquwajQE6pHC
  • 17f15878bfdad890c6db6f93736719713edc995f500c5ee50d66c23d05a13d29:1
  • value  28598104
    address  16W6hDj2QSheuEFQfLfjDXXinC7YfuhAaS